Michael A. Tompkins
Assistant Clinical Professor, University of California-Berkeley

Pronouns: he/him/his
Michael A. Tompkins, Ph.D., specializes in treating adults, adolescents, and children with anxiety disorders, stress, insomnia, body-focused repetitive behaviors, elimination disorders, and Tourette’s/tic disorders.
He has given over 300 workshops, lectures, and keynote presentations and has been featured in The New York Times, The Wall Street Journal and on The Learning Channel, Arts & Entertainment, and NPR. Dr. Tompkins is the author or co-author of numerous clinical articles and book chapters on cognitive-behavior therapy as well as twelve books and three APA Psychotherapy Training Videos.
